    I have got a American style Samsung Fridge Frezer and the freezer is playing up. It is about 5 years old and the freezr has started to stop freezing. The display will remin at -18 but checking inside the temperature will warm to room temperature. If you turn it off and on again the display shows the correct temperature and it all works and cools down to -18 but once it reaches -18 the fan stops and it starts to warm again but the display will show -18. If i put it on power freeze it appears to work fine.

    Has anyone got any ideas to what this might be, i was thinking it might be the temperature sensor but turning it off and on again and it all works fine until it reaches the correct temperature?

    Is there any problems if i just permanently leave it on power freeze will it burn out a motor or anything?

    Check the defrost heater,And or the heater plug as they tend to come out.

    No i mean the defrost heater plug. You could also try replacing the defrost sensor ( the yellow wires with either a white or black end )
